Tasting Notes and Scores

87-89 NM

A blend of 81% Merlot and 19% Cabernet Franc, with 16% pressed wine and coming in at 13.9% alcohol, the Fugue de Nenin has a surprisingly reticent nose with crisp red-berried fruits, a touch of sandalwood and bell pepper, unfurling a little with time in the glass. The palate is medium-bodied with rounded, slightly digestif tannins (that remind me of Tertre-Roteboeuf.) Soft and supple on the finish with cooked meats on the aftertaste. Fine. Tasted April 2010.

Neal Martin

87-89 IDA

(a blend of 81% merlot and 19% cabernet franc; 13.9% alcohol; 20% new oak) Medium-dark ruby. Pure, vibrant aromas and flavors of blackcurrant, blackberry syrup and smoky plum. Fresh on entry, then juicy, clean and nicely balanced, finishing long and satisfying, with high-quality tannins. The best-ever Fugue I can recall, and a wine that should provide plenty of early drinking appeal.

Ian D'Agata

Vinous

2010-05-01

87 RMPJ

The Fugue de Nenin is a delicious, soft, finesse-styled Pomerol with elegant mulberry, plum, cherry fruit. Dark ruby, with a hint of spring flowers, it is best drunk over the next decade.

Robert M. Parker, Jr.
